How much do undercover military j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 26, 2026, the average hourly pay for undercover military in the United States is $26.04,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$18.27 and $35.10 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some of the main challenges faced by undercover military personnel in their day-to-day work?

Undercover military personnel regularly face challenges such as maintaining their cover identity under stressful and unpredictable conditions, adapting to rapidly changing situations, and operating with limited support. The role often requires independent problem-solving while managing the psychological pressure of potential discovery. Success relies on closely following mission protocols, collaborating secretly with other team members, and staying alert to shifting threats. Because of the sensitive nature of assignments, adaptability and emotional resilience are essential. These unique challenges make the role demanding but vital for national security and intelligence gathering.

Can I join a PMC with no experience?

Joining a private military company (PMC) typically requires prior military or security experience, as these roles often demand specialized skills such as combat training, firearms proficiency, and security protocols. While some companies may offer entry-level positions, most prefer candidates with relevant background and certifications like security training or tactical courses.

What is an Undercover Military job?

An Undercover Military job involves personnel operating covertly to gather intelligence, conduct special operations, or infiltrate hostile environments without revealing their true identity. These roles require advanced training in espionage, surveillance, and combat tactics. Operatives may work alongside intelligence agencies, special forces, or other military units to support national security. Due to the sensitive nature of the job, details about specific missions and assignments are classified.
